Problems solved by technology

[0003] After the structure of the rubber pad suspension vibration isolation passive control device is determined, the vibration isolation characteristics are also determined, which cannot adapt to sudden changes in the interference frequency
Active control technology requires additional energy. The control system includes state monitors, control systems, and actuators. The control system requires a reasonable and stable control algorithm, and the real-time requirements for state monitors and actuators are very high. Manufacturing, operation and maintenance costs are very high, and are greatly restricted in practical application in ships
Active control technology is difficult to apply to the vibration control of actual marine diesel engines due to high energy consumption and complex algorithm of the control system

Abstract

The invention discloses a system and a method for suppressing vibrations of a marine diesel engine, wherein the system comprises a first sensor that is mounted on the diesel engine and used for measuring a first acceleration of the diesel engine, a second sensor that is mounted on a ship body and used for measuring a second acceleration of the ship body, a damper mounted between the diesel engine and the ship body, and a control device that connected with the first sensor, the second sensor and the damper and used for controlling, according to the first acceleration and the second acceleration, a damping force generated by the damper to do negative work to the diesel engine to consume the vibration energy of the diesel engine, thereby inhibiting the vibrations of the diesel engine. The system for suppressing the vibrations of the marine diesel engine realizes semi-active control on the vibrations of the diesel engine by means of the damping force-controllable damper without an extra actuator, and therefore, the energy consumption cost is low; besides, the system only needs to control the on and off states of the damper according to the vibration conditions of the diesel engine, and the control method thus is simple and easy to realize.

technical field [0001] The invention relates to a marine diesel engine, in particular to a system and method for suppressing vibration of a marine diesel engine. Background technique [0002] With the rapid growth of global economic integration, the ocean transportation industry has been developing continuously and rapidly. The ocean transportation industry has become an important factor in promoting global economic integration. The development of the marine transportation industry is inseparable from the development of ships, and diesel engines are the main power source in the ship field. Excessive vibration of the marine diesel engine will reduce the reliability and service life of the diesel engine itself, and even cause the vibration isolation pad to tear. The vibration transmitted to the hull and the noise generated by the vibration seriously affect the comfort of the user.
